1. Early Beginnings: A Star in the Making
From humble beginnings in Clinton, Oklahoma, Toby Keith’s journey to stardom is one of perseverance and passion.
With his debut single “Should’ve Been a Cowboy,” released in 1993, Keith burst onto the country music scene, capturing the hearts of listeners with his authentic storytelling and rugged charm.
2. Unapologetic Patriotism: “Courtesy of the Red, White and Blue”
One of Toby Keith’s most iconic songs, “Courtesy of the Red, White and Blue,” emerged as a powerful anthem of American pride and resilience in the wake of the September 11 attacks.
With its bold lyrics and stirring melody, the song struck a chord with audiences, cementing Keith’s reputation as a patriot and a voice for the nation.

6. Collaborations and Duets: “Beer for My Horses” with Willie Nelson
Toby Keith’s collaborations with fellow artists have yielded some of his most memorable songs. ”
Beer for My Horses,” a duet with country music legend Willie Nelson, combines Keith’s signature sound with Nelson’s iconic vocals, creating a timeless classic that continues to resonate with fans.
